Definitions
verb
Definition
To touch someone gently in a loving or affectionate way.

Cultural Notes
In many cultures, caressing is seen as an expression of love and intimacy, often between family members, friends, or romantic partners.
adjective
Definition
Having the quality of being gentle and loving, often used to describe a soothing or pleasant sensation.

Cultural Notes
While describing something as caressing can be flattering, it is mostly used in a poetic or romantic context, adding a layer of intimacy to the description.
